What Is Home Automation?
Home automation refers to the use of technology to control and automate household systems and devices, such as lighting, heating, cooling, security, and entertainment. With a centralized system—accessible through a smartphone, tablet, or voice commands—home automation allows you to manage your home remotely or set schedules for devices to operate automatically.
Think of it as upgrading your home with "smart" capabilities. For example, instead of physically turning off your lights before bed, you can simply say, "Turn off all lights," and your smart assistant takes care of it. Alternatively, you can program your coffee maker to start brewing as soon as your alarm goes off, so you wake up to the smell of fresh coffee. Sound like a dream? The Benefits of Home Automation
Home automation offers more than just convenience. Once you incorporate smart technology into your home, you'll quickly see its many benefits, including:
1. Unmatched Convenience
Imagine controlling every aspect of your home with a single app or voice command. With home automation, you can adjust lighting, lock doors, change the thermostat, and even operate appliances without lifting a finger. Automation allows you to customize your routines—for example, programming your home to "wake up" with you by turning on lights and playing your favorite music every morning.
2. Energy Efficiency and Cost Savings
Smart devices can help you lower your energy consumption. Smart thermostats, for instance, learn your preferences and adjust temperatures when you're not home to conserve energy. Similarly, automated lights with motion sensors can turn off when a room is empty. Over time, energy-efficient automation reduces your monthly bills while benefiting the environment.
3. Enhanced Home Security
The integration of smart security cameras, door locks, and alarm systems adds an extra layer of protection. Home automation allows you to monitor your home in real-time through your smartphone, receive alerts for suspicious activity, and lock or unlock doors remotely. Some systems even implement facial recognition for a personalized approach to security.
4. Improved Home Comfort
Home automation brings comfort to a whole new level. Adjust your home's temperature to perfection before you walk in, preheat the oven on your way home from work, or dim the lights for a cozy movie night—all with a simple tap on your phone. With automation, you can create an environment tailor-made to your preferences, anytime.
5. Universal Accessibility
For individuals with limited mobility, home automation can be life-changing. Voice-controlled smart devices, automated door locks, and other technologies empower users to manage their homes independently with minimal physical effort.

Popular Home Automation Devices
The beauty of home automation lies in the sheer variety of devices available, catering to different needs and preferences. Here’s a look at some of the most popular smart devices that can transform your home:
1. Smart Speakers and Assistants
At the heart of any home automation setup is a smart assistant, such as Amazon Alexa, Google Assistant, or Apple Siri. These devices not only answer questions but also serve as the control hub for many other smart devices in your home.
2. Smart Lighting
Smart bulbs, strips, and switches can be scheduled, dimmed, or even change colors based on your mood. Popular brands like Philips Hue and LIFX offer a wide range of customizable options to suit your lifestyle.
3. Smart Thermostats
Thermostats like Nest and ecobee learn your habits to create an energy-efficient schedule, providing optimal comfort while cutting down on heating and cooling costs.
4. Smart Security Systems
Smart security includes cameras, video doorbells, and motion sensors from brands like Ring and Arlo. These devices offer real-time monitoring and alerts to keep your home safe at all times.
5. Smart Plugs and Outlets
These nifty devices allow you to control ordinary appliances—like lamps, coffee makers, and fans—from your smartphone. Simply plug them into a smart outlet for instant control.
6. Robot Vacuum Cleaners
Brands like iRobot offer autonomous vacuum cleaners that keep your floors clean without effort. Some models even integrate with voice assistants for hands-free operation.
7. Smart Appliances
Refrigerators, ovens, washing machines, and even mirrors are becoming smarter! With brands like LG and Samsung leading the charge, these appliances connect to apps and voice assistants for more control and functionality.

How to Get Started with Home Automation
Creating a smart home doesn’t have to be complicated or expensive. Here are some straightforward steps to help you get started:
1. Define Your Goals
Ask yourself what you want to achieve with home automation. Is it energy savings, enhanced security, or simplified home management? Defining your priorities will guide you on which devices or systems to invest in.
2. Start Small
You don’t have to automate everything at once! Begin with one or two devices that address your specific needs, such as a smart speaker and a security camera. Once you're comfortable, scale up gradually.
3. Choose the Right Ecosystem
Decide which smart assistant (Alexa, Google Assistant, or Siri) you’d like to use. This choice will influence the compatibility of devices you add to your home.
4. Set a Budget
Smart technology now caters to all price ranges. Set a realistic budget to guide your purchases and stick to it. Remember, it's easy to upgrade later.
5. Focus on Compatibility
Ensure all devices are compatible with your chosen ecosystem to simplify setup and integration. Platforms like Samsung SmartThings or Apple HomeKit are great for managing multiple devices.
6. Learn and Experiment
Take time to learn the functionality of each device and experiment with its capabilities. For example, create automation routines such as "Good Night," which locks your doors, dims the lights, and lowers the temperature—all with a single command.
